Onedrive is a cloud storage service offered by Microsoft that lets you store ‍your⁤ documents, photos and other important files in the cloud from ‌any device. 1. Download ​Onedrive for Windows 7

Installing Onedrive on Windows ⁤7⁣ is easy! ⁣ ‍All you ⁣need to do⁢ is ⁣follow ⁤these steps and you’ll be syncing your files⁤ in⁢ no time.

  • Select the Download button – From⁣ the Onedrive website, find the ⁣download button and select it.
  • Run ‍the​ Onedrive installation wizard ⁣ – Follow​ the instructions⁢ provided by the wizard,⁤ you’ll need to agree ​to the terms of service‌ before continuing.
  • Sign into your Microsoft ‌account – Use your Microsoft​ account to sign in and finish installing Onedrive.

Once you’ve logged in, you can view ⁤all ⁤of ‍your stored files and folders in Onedrive. You can⁣ easily share ⁣files ‌and‌ collaborate on projects ⁤with friends⁣ and colleagues, or ​keep them private. ‌ You‍ can also access your files from any​ computer⁣ or device with an internet ⁣connection.
